Infinity Edge Pools for Luxurious Views

An infinity edge pool overlooking a sunset with mountains in the background.

Infinity edge pools are a stunning feature that can elevate any hotel’s design. They create a seamless transition between the water and the horizon, making it feel like the pool extends into the sky.

Imagine lounging by a pool that appears to flow into the sunset. The tranquil water reflects the vibrant colors of the sky, creating a breathtaking view. This design draws guests in, inviting them to relax and soak in the beauty around them.

These pools are often placed on elevated terraces, offering panoramic views of the landscape. Whether it’s mountains, oceans, or cityscapes, the scenery becomes part of the experience.

Infinity pools also provide a sense of privacy. The edge creates a natural barrier, allowing guests to enjoy their surroundings without feeling exposed. This makes them perfect for a luxurious getaway.

Incorporating an infinity edge pool into hotel design is not just about aesthetics. It enhances the overall experience, making every moment spent by the water memorable.

Eco-Friendly Pools with Natural Filtration

Eco-friendly hotel pool with natural filtration surrounded by greenery

Imagine a pool that blends seamlessly with nature. This eco-friendly design showcases a beautiful pool surrounded by lush greenery. The natural filtration system uses plants and rocks to keep the water clean, eliminating the need for harsh chemicals.

The pool features gentle waterfalls that not only add a soothing sound but also help circulate the water. The stone edges create a rustic look, enhancing the natural vibe. This design is perfect for those who want a relaxing retreat right in their backyard.

With comfortable seating nearby, it invites you to unwind and enjoy the serene environment. This setup is not just visually appealing; it promotes sustainability and a connection to nature.
